Don't Just Sit There, FIGHT

Ephesians 6:10-12
Finally, be strong in the Lord in His mighty power. Put on the full armor of God so that you can take your stand against the devil's schemes. For our struggle is not against flesh and blood, but against the rulers, against the authorities, against the powers of this dark world and against the spiritual forces of evil in the heavenly realms.

Notice all these phrases:

Be strong. Be spiritually powerful, tough, resilient in the Lord. Be empowered through your union with God. Draw strength from Him.

Put on. This is a command to commit to action. It is something that we must do. We're never told to take off.

Full armor of God. Every time it is mentioned it is the full or whole armor. Without putting on the full armor of God we won't be fully equipped for battle.

Here are some of the devil's schemes:  pride - lies - fear - discouragement - anger - complaining - gossip - regret - greed - self-pity - laziness - unfaithfulness - worry - anxiety; just to name a few.

Too long have we just got comfortable in our church pews and comfortable building churches that we forgot that we're meant to cause a righteous ruckus with holy indignation that hates mediocrity and self-absorption. We go to church not for our sake but to give the enemy a break.

Our battle isn't with the theology of another. Our battle isn't with an atheist, a homosexual, or a satanist. It is with the one who is behind all of it playing the puppeteer. Our battle is with:

The rulers. A person (in this case a spirit) exercising dominion.

The authorities. The power or right to give orders, make decisions, and enforce obedience.

The powers. The capability of doing or accomplishing something.

The forces. The capacity or active power to cause change.

This is not as cartoonist portray it as the fat angel and seductive devil on our shoulders. There is a spiritual battle that we are fighting. There is no spectating.
